Publisher's summary

“Want to understand the changing world? Start with what stays the same. That’s the amazing conclusion of Morgan Housel’s fascinating, useful, and highly-entertaining book.”

— Arthur C. Brooks, Professor, Harvard Kennedy School and Harvard Business School, and #1 New York Times bestselling author


From the author of the international blockbuster THE PSYCHOLOGY OF MONEY, a powerful new tool to unlock one of life’s most challenging puzzles.


Every investment plan under the sun is, at best, an informed speculation of what may happen in the future, based on a systematic extrapolation from the known past.

Same as Ever reverses the process, inviting us to identify the many things that never, ever change.

With his usual elan, Morgan Housel presents a master class on optimizing risk, seizing opportunity, and living your best life. Through a sequence of engaging stories and pithy examples, he shows how we can use our newfound grasp of the unchanging to see around corners, not by squinting harder through the uncertain landscape of the future, but by looking backwards, being more broad-sighted, and focusing instead on what is permanently true.

By doing so, we may better anticipate the big stuff, and achieve the greatest success, not merely financial comforts, but most importantly, a life well lived.

Full of Wisdom - However...

However, I would not title this book "Same as Ever".
While it is indeed packed with wisdom which was rightfully relevant both 100 years ago and 100 years in the future (hence, the title), this title can be true for many books about human behavior. For example, a book about people falling in love and breaking up could easily also be named Same as Ever. There were some topics I expected in the book which were absent:
The lindy effect - was not deliberately addressed but was kind of refuted through examples from evolution... How could the lindy effect not even be mentioned as it is literally connected to the idea of things that last...
War was addressed - but not closely enough. He didn't try to answer if there always be war. Is war also "Same as Ever"?
Will people always eat meat?
Racism?
Corruption in Politics?
Was expecting these topics...
Still, will give five stars for wisdom packed extremely well and with a lot of compassion as well...
